-namespace {
-
-// It would be easy to accidentally trample on the Windows LastError value
-// by adding logging/debugging code. Ensure that can't happen by saving and
-// restoring the value. This saving and restoring doesn't happen along the
-// fast path.
-class PreserveLastError {
-public:
- PreserveLastError() : m_lastError(GetLastError()) {}
- ~PreserveLastError() { SetLastError(m_lastError); }
-private:
- DWORD m_lastError;
-};
-
-} // anonymous namespace

-static void sendToDebugServer(const char *message)
-{
- HANDLE tracePipe = INVALID_HANDLE_VALUE;
-
- do {
- // The default impersonation level is SECURITY_IMPERSONATION, which allows
- // a sufficiently authorized named pipe server to impersonate the client.
- // There's no need for impersonation in this debugging system, so reduce
- // the impersonation level to SECURITY_IDENTIFICATION, which allows a
- // server to merely identify us.
- tracePipe = CreateFileW(
- kPipeName,
- GENERIC_READ | GENERIC_WRITE,
- 0, NULL, OPEN_EXISTING,
- SECURITY_SQOS_PRESENT | SECURITY_IDENTIFICATION,
- NULL);
- } while (tracePipe == INVALID_HANDLE_VALUE &&
- GetLastError() == ERROR_PIPE_BUSY &&
- WaitNamedPipeW(kPipeName, NMPWAIT_WAIT_FOREVER));
-
- if (tracePipe != INVALID_HANDLE_VALUE) {
- DWORD newMode = PIPE_READMODE_MESSAGE;
- SetNamedPipeHandleState(tracePipe, &newMode, NULL, NULL);
- char response[16];
- DWORD actual = 0;
- TransactNamedPipe(tracePipe,
- const_cast<char*>(message), strlen(message),
- response, sizeof(response), &actual, NULL);
- CloseHandle(tracePipe);
- }
-}
-
-// Get the current UTC time as milliseconds from the epoch (ignoring leap
-// seconds). Use the Unix epoch for consistency with DebugClient.py. There
-// are 134774 days between 1601-01-01 (the Win32 epoch) and 1970-01-01 (the
-// Unix epoch).
-static long long unixTimeMillis()
-{
- FILETIME fileTime;
- GetSystemTimeAsFileTime(&fileTime);
- long long msTime = (((long long)fileTime.dwHighDateTime << 32) +
- fileTime.dwLowDateTime) / 10000;
- return msTime - 134774LL * 24 * 3600 * 1000;
-}
